I'm with Straycat there it would be a very costly mistake to rout out cavity to put in a humbucker.As a matter of fact I wouldn't have done anything to a Tele of that vintage as even CBS Fenders are going up in value and any mods reversable or not greatly affect the value as even the original solder joins are prefered by collectors and new solder means not original,yes collectors are that fussy.
